Breaking Down the Features of NGK Spark Plugs 5329 Spark Plug Dpr9Ea 9

Specifications

The NGK Spark Plugs 5329 Spark Plug Dpr9Ea 9 is a single ignition component designed for internal combustion engines. Its construction highlights include a high alumina ceramics insulator, which is key for its better heat transfer and electrical insulation properties. The core of the plug features a solid copper core, a traditional material known for excellent conductivity, paired with a nickel tipped electrode for enhanced durability and spark quality. NGK’s proprietary patented triple gasket sealing process is a critical design element, designed to prevent combustion gas leaks and ensure a secure seal. This specific model, the DPR9EA-9, is engineered to operate over a significantly wider heat range than standard plugs, which directly contributes to its resistance against carbon buildup and pre-ignition.

These specifications translate directly into tangible benefits for the end-user. The high alumina ceramics not only provide superior electrical insulation, preventing flashover, but also efficiently dissipate heat away from the firing tip. This is crucial for preventing pre-ignition, a damaging condition where the fuel-air mixture ignites too early in the combustion cycle. The solid copper core acts as an excellent conductor, ensuring that the electrical energy from the ignition system is effectively delivered to the electrode for a strong spark. The nickel tipped electrode is chosen for its durability and resistance to electrode erosion, which is a primary factor in maintaining consistent spark plug performance over time. Finally, the patented triple gasket sealing process is a critical but often overlooked feature; it guarantees that the plug remains sealed under the high pressures and temperatures of combustion, preventing loss of compression and ensuring efficient engine operation.

Durability & Maintenance

Based on my extended testing and my experience with similar components, the NGK Spark Plugs 5329 Spark Plug Dpr9Ea 9 is designed for a good service life. While I haven’t accumulated enough mileage to test its ultimate lifespan, the solid copper core and nickel tipped electrode suggest it will offer a much longer period of reliable service than cheaper, unbranded alternatives. It falls into the category of a long-lasting, yet eventually replaceable, maintenance item for most vehicles.

Maintenance for this type of spark plug is essentially non-existent beyond ensuring proper installation. There are no parts to clean or lubricate. The design inherently resists the buildup of carbon and oil deposits due to its wider operating heat range and quality materials. The main point to watch out for during maintenance is during installation and removal; over-tightening can damage the cylinder head threads, while insufficient tightening can lead to a poor seal or vibration issues. The patented triple gasket sealing process is designed to compress slightly upon installation, so a proper torque is essential for longevity and sealing. I haven’t encountered any specific failure points, but as with any spark plug, physical damage during handling or installation can compromise its integrity.
